Gennari A, Brain E, De Censi A, Nanni O, Wuerstlein R, Frassoldati A, Cortes J, Rossi V, Palleschi M, Alberini JL, Matteucci F, Piccardo A, Sacchetti G, Ilhan H, D'Avanzo F, Ruffilli B, Nardin S, Monti M, Puntoni M, Fontana V, Boni L, Harbeck N. Early prediction of endocrine responsiveness in ER+/HER2-negative metastatic breast cancer (MBC): Pilot study with 18F-Fluoroestradiol (18F-FES) CT/PET. Ann Oncol 2024:S0923-7534(24)00057-7. [PMID: 38423389 DOI: 10.1016/j.annonc.2024.02.007] [Citation(s) in RCA: 0] [Impact Index Per Article: 0] [Reference Citation Analysis] [What about the content of this article? (0)] [Affiliation(s)] [Abstract] [Key Words] [Journal Information] [Subscribe] [Scholar Register] [Received: 06/20/2023] [Revised: 01/15/2024] [Accepted: 02/20/2024] [Indexed: 03/02/2024] Open
Abstract
BACKGROUND 18F-FES PET/CT is considered an accurate diagnostic tool to determine whole-body endocrine responsiveness. In the ET-FES trial, we evaluated 18F-FES PET/CT as a predictive tool in ER+/HER2- metastatic breast cancer (MBC). METHODS Eligible patients underwent a 18F-FES PET/CT at baseline. Patients with SUV≥2 received single agent ET until PD; patients with SUV<2 were randomized to single agent ET (Arm A) or chemotherapy (CT) (Arm B). Primary objective was to compare the activity of first line ET versus CT in patients with 18F-FES SUV <2. RESULTS Overall, 147 patients were enrolled; 117 presented with 18F-FES SUV≥2 and received ET; 30 pts with SUV<2 were randomized to ET or CT. After a median follow up of 62.4 months, 104 patients (73.2%) had disease progression and 53 died (37.3%). Median PFS was 12.4 months (95%CI 3.1-59.6) in patients with SUV <2 randomised to Arm A versus 23.0 months (95%CI 7.7-30.0) in Arm B, (HR = 0.71, 95%CI 0.3 - 1.7); median PFS was 18.0 months (95%CI 11.2-23.1) in patients with SUV≥2 treated with ET. Median OS was 28.2 months (95%CI 14.2-NE) in patients with SUV <2 randomized to ET (Arm A) versus 52.8 months (95%CI 16.2-NE) in Arm B (CT). Median OS was not reached in patients with SUV≥2. 60-month OS rate was 41.6% (95%CI 10.4-71.1%) in Arm A, 42.0% (95%CI 14.0-68.2%) in Arm B and 59.6% (95%CI 48.6-69.0%) in patients with SUV≥2. In patients with SUV≥2, 60-months OS rate was 72.6% if treated with aromatase inhibitors versus 40.6% in case of fulvestrant or tamoxifen (p<0.005). CONCLUSIONS The ET-FES trial demonstrated that ER+/HER2- MBC patients are a heterogeneous population, with different levels of endocrine responsiveness based on 18F-FES CT/PET SUV.

Boughdad S, Champion L, Becette V, Cherel P, Fourme E, Edeline V, Lemonnier J, Lerebours F, Alberini JL. Abstract P4-01-03: Predictive value of FDG-PET/CT after neoadjuvant endocrine treatment in breast cancer. Cancer Res 2017. [DOI: 10.1158/1538-7445.sabcs16-p4-01-03] [Citation(s) in RCA: 0] [Impact Index Per Article: 0] [Reference Citation Analysis] [What about the content of this article? (0)] [Affiliation(s)] [Abstract] [Track Full Text] [Journal Information] [Subscribe] [Scholar Register] [Indexed: 11/16/2022]
Abstract
Abstract
Background: Neaodjuvant endocrine therapy (NET) has demonstrated efficacy in terms of clinical response and outcome in hormone-receptor positive (HR+) post-menopausal patients (pts) with breast cancer (BC) not eligible for primary breast conservative surgery (BCS). However, the monitoring of tumor response to NET is challenging and clinical response is the current gold standard. The aim of the present study was to investigate the contribution of the early metabolic response (eMR) at one month in FDG-PET/CT in a NET setting for post-menopausal pts with HR+, HER2- BC compared to morphological and pathological responses. We also aimed to evaluate the prognostic value of eMR.
Methods: This was a prospective and ancillary study of CARMINA 02, UCBG0609 (Cancer in press), a phase II clinical trial evaluating the efficacy of 4 to 6 months neoadjuvant anastrozole or fulvestrant. FDG-PET/CT exams were performed at baseline (M0), after 1 month of treatment (M1: eMR) and pre-Op (late metabolic response: lMR) in 11 pts (74.2 years ± 3.6) from 2007 to 2010. Pts were classified “metabolic responders” (mR) if SUVmax values decrease was ≥ 40% at M1 and “non-metabolic responders” (mNR) if otherwise; lMR was also assessed in mR and mNR groups defined at M1. We compared eMR to morphological response (clinical, breast US and MRI) at M1 and pre-op, to the pathological response according to Sataloff classification and to Ki67 score variation during treatment. Early metabolic response was also correlated with the PEPI (Preoperative Endocrine Prognostic Index) score and survival (overall survival, OS and relapse free survival, RFS).
Results: Main results are summarized in Table I. There was a significant difference between mR and mNR pts at M1 (eMR) and pre-op (lMR). One patient with a complete metabolic response at pre-op had the best pathological response (Sataloff TB). Also, mR pts had a better clinical response: 2 partial response (PR) in mR vs 1 in mNR group and 2 mNR patients were classified PD (progressive disease). There was a trend toward better survival for mR pts in OS and RFS (Kaplan-Meier p=0.18 and 0.06, respectively) and all the pejorative events occurred in the mNR group: 3 deaths and 3 metastatic progressions. Besides, no difference in eMR was observed regarding the histological subtype (ductal or lobular; p>0.05) nor the treatment group (p>0.05).
Table I: Metabolic, morphological and pathological response at M1, Pre-Op and on the surgical specimen. Conclusions: These preliminary results showed the value of the early metabolic response in FDG- PET/CT in a NET setting compared to the morphological or the pathological responses alone. Early metabolic responders patients had better OS, RFS and PEPI scores.

Decaudin D, Kadouche J, Levy R, Belhamiche M, Arnaud P, Alberini JL, Lokiec FM, Pecking AP. Radioimmunotherapy (RIT) of refractory or relapsed Hodgkin’s lymphoma with 90Yttrium-labeled antiferritin antibody. J Clin Oncol 2006. [DOI: 10.1200/jco.2006.24.18_suppl.2534] [Citation(s) in RCA: 0] [Impact Index Per Article: 0] [Reference Citation Analysis] [What about the content of this article? (0)] [Affiliation(s)] [Abstract] [Track Full Text] [Journal Information] [Subscribe] [Scholar Register] [Indexed: 11/20/2022] Open
Abstract
2534 Background: The aims of this study were to evaluate (1) the tumor targeting of 111Indium-labeled rabbit polyclonal antiferritin antibody (Ab) and (2) the therapeutic efficacy of 90Yttrium-labeled antiferritin Ab in relapsed or refractory Hodgkin’s lymphoma (HL) patients (pts). Methods: After obtention of the patients’ consent, the protocol included a first intravenous injection of 2 mg of antiferritin Ab labeled to 111 MBq (3 mCi) of 111Indium followed by immunoscintigraphy at time 24 and 48 hours and, in case of tumor targeting, one or more intravenous injections of 90Yttrium-labeled antiferritin Ab at various activities. Results: Ten patients were included in the study: median age 32 years (range: 18–43 years); sex ratio M/F 9; stages III and IV at the time of RIT 1 and 9 pts, respectively; median number of chemotherapy regimens 3 (range: 2–4); number of autografted pts 8; number of previously irradiated pts 9; response to last chemotherapy: 6 PR and 4 progressions. All immunoscintigraphies showed a tumor targeting by 111Indium-labeled antiferritin Ab. Nine patients were treated, one case died of HL evolution. Five pts received one 90Yttrium-labeled antiferritin Ab injection, three pts 2 injections (0.5, 5 et 14 months after the first one), and one pt 4 injections (3, 9 et 16 months after the first one). Median injected activity was 13 MBq/kg (0.35 mCi/kg)(range: 7–15 MBq). Among the 9 treated pts, 1 CR, 6 PR, 1 stable disease, and 1 tumor progression were observed (ORR 78%). The median duration of responses were 8 months (range: 7–12 months). Toxicity was mainly hematological, with neutropenia and anemia of grades 1 or 2, and thrombopenia of grades 2 and 3; one pt presented a generalized convulsive crisis 24 hours after the therapeutic injection, without etiologic evidence. Conclusion: These results confirmed those that have been reported by Vriesendorp and Quadri and showed that rabbit polyclonal antiferritin Ab targeted HL tumor sites and had an important therapeutic potential in this discrepancy situation. Abad S, Meyssonier V, Allali J, Gouya H, Giraudet AL, Monnet D, Parc C, Tenenbaum F, Alberini JL, Grabar S, Pesce F, Rollot F, Sicard D, Dhote R, Blanche P, Brézin AP. Association of peripheral multifocal choroiditis with sarcoidosis: a study of thirty-seven patients. ACTA ACUST UNITED AC 2005; 51:974-82. [PMID: 15593175 DOI: 10.1002/art.20839] [Citation(s) in RCA: 57] [Impact Index Per Article: 3.0] [Reference Citation Analysis] [What about the content of this article? (0)] [Affiliation(s)] [Abstract] [MESH Headings] [Track Full Text] [Journal Information] [Subscribe] [Scholar Register] [Indexed: 11/07/2022]
Abstract
OBJECTIVE To assess the clinical spectrum of peripheral multifocal choroiditis (PMC) and its association with sarcoidosis. METHODS Thirty-seven patients examined between November 1997 and November 2001 who met all diagnostic criteria for PMC were included in this retrospective study. Patients were assessed for the following signs of sarcoidosis: typical changes on chest radiography or computed tomography; predominantly CD4 lymphocytosis in bronchoalveolar lavage fluid; elevated serum angiotensin-converting enzyme levels; elevated gallium uptake; and noncaseating granuloma on biopsy. RESULTS Most of the patients were female (30 of 37; 81%) and white (30 of 37; 81%). Mean +/- SD age at onset was 57.5 +/- 18.7 years. Seven (19%) of the 37 patients had biopsy-proven sarcoidosis and 18 patients (49%) with presumed sarcoidosis met at least 2 of the above-mentioned criteria for sarcoidosis but had normal biopsy results. Twelve patients (32%) had an indeterminate diagnosis. Patients with presumed sarcoidosis did not differ from those with proven sarcoidosis as regards the above-mentioned criteria, except for noncaseating granuloma, implying that more than two-thirds of patients (predominantly whites) had underlying sarcoidosis. Most patients with positive gallium scintigraphy had increased mediastinal uptake, as described in sarcoidosis. Patients with underlying sarcoidosis had more severe visual impairment due to cystoid macular edema (CME). Weekly methotrexate (0.3 mg/kg) seemed to control CME. CONCLUSION White patients with PMC should be considered to have sarcoidosis. The identification of sarcoidosis in patients with severe ocular disease can help with therapeutic choices.

Alberini JL, Belhocine T, Hustinx R, Daenen F, Rigo P. Whole-body positron emission tomography using fluorodeoxyglucose in patients with metastases of unknown primary tumours (CUP syndrome). Nucl Med Commun 2004; 24:1081-6. [PMID: 14508164 DOI: 10.1097/00006231-200310000-00008] [Citation(s) in RCA: 35] [Impact Index Per Article: 1.8] [Reference Citation Analysis] [What about the content of this article? (0)] [Affiliation(s)] [Abstract] [MESH Headings] [Track Full Text] [Journal Information] [Subscribe] [Scholar Register] [Indexed: 11/25/2022]
Abstract
The aim of this study was to evaluate the clinical performances of whole body 2-[18F]fluorodeoxyglucose positron emission tomography (FDG PET) imaging for the detection of the primary tumour in patients with metastases of unknown origin. Forty-one patients, without previous history of known cancer (18 women and 23 men; average age 64.1 years) with metastasis confirmed by histopathological analysis were included in a retrospective study. Results of PET were compared with those of techniques used in the current conventional diagnostic procedure. All known metastatic lesions were detected by PET. There were 26 true-positive and two false-negative results. Primary tumour remained undetermined in eight patients after conventional investigations and PET. PET was superior to conventional diagnostic procedure in 11 patients and led to modify treatment in 11 patients. Sensitivity of PET was superior than computed tomography in detecting abdominal primary tumours. FDG PET is useful in patients with unknown primary tumour because its sensitivity is good and it could modify the disease management. Otherwise, PET allows the evaluation of the extent of the disease and could be used to monitor treatment efficiency. Its contribution has to be evaluated particularly in patients with primary tumour with a specific treatment.

Bertherat J, Tenenbaum F, Perlemoine K, Videau C, Alberini JL, Richard B, Dousset B, Bertagna X, Epelbaum J. Somatostatin receptors 2 and 5 are the major somatostatin receptors in insulinomas: an in vivo and in vitro study. J Clin Endocrinol Metab 2003; 88:5353-60. [PMID: 14602773 DOI: 10.1210/jc.2002-021895] [Citation(s) in RCA: 89] [Impact Index Per Article: 4.2] [Reference Citation Analysis] [What about the content of this article? (0)] [Affiliation(s)] [Abstract] [MESH Headings] [Track Full Text] [Journal Information] [Submit a Manuscript] [Subscribe] [Scholar Register] [Indexed: 12/14/2022]
Abstract
Somatostatin (SRIF) receptors (sst) are present on normal pancreatic endocrine beta-cells. However, the use of SRIF analogs in the scintigraphic imaging of insulinomas and in the medical management of these tumors seems to be restricted to a subgroup of patients. The aim of this study was to determine the prevalence of sst expression in vitro and characterize sst subtype binding in insulinomas and its correlation with in vivo sst receptor scintigraphy (SRS). In vitro studies were performed on 27 insulinomas from 25 patients: 22 with benign and three with malignant tumors. Semiquantitative RT-PCR of sst mRNAs was performed for 20 of these insulinomas. Sst2 and sst5 were expressed in 70%, sst1 in 50%, and sst3 and sst4 subtypes only in 15-20% of the tumors. (125)I-Tyr(0)DTrp(8)SRIF(14) binding was assessed by quantitative autoradiography in 18 insulinomas, and competition experiments were performed with SRIF(14) and L797-591, L779-976, L796-778, L803-087, L817-818, selective agonists of the five sst subtypes, and BIM23244, a selective agonist of sst2 and sst5. Significant specific binding was observed in 72% of the insulinomas. Displacement experiments with ligands of higher affinity for each of the sst receptors revealed significant binding with the sst2 and sst5 ligands in 72%, sst3 in 44%, sst1 in 44%, and sst4 in 28% of cases. All insulinomas displaying sst2 binding were also sst5 sensitive. However, the ratio of sst5/sst2 displacement was variable and only equal to that for SRIF(14) in experiments with the sst2/sst5 agonist BIM23244. SRS was performed 10 times in nine patients; it detected 60% of the tumors, including metastases of a malignant insulinoma. All the tumors detected by SRS displayed high levels of (125)I-Tyr(0)DTrp(8)SRIF(14) binding. The mechanisms underlying the loss of expression of sst2/sst5 in a third of insulinomas remains to be determined, but this loss of expression may be involved in beta-cell dysfunction.

Pecking AP, Mechelany-Corone C, Bertrand-Kermorgant F, Alberini JL, Floiras JL, Goupil A, Pichon MF. Detection of occult disease in breast cancer using fluorodeoxyglucose camera-based positron emission tomography. Clin Breast Cancer 2001; 2:229-34. [PMID: 11899417 DOI: 10.3816/cbc.2001.n.026] [Citation(s) in RCA: 30] [Impact Index Per Article: 1.3] [Reference Citation Analysis] [What about the content of this article? (0)] [Affiliation(s)] [Abstract] [MESH Headings] [Track Full Text] [Journal Information] [Subscribe] [Scholar Register] [Indexed: 11/20/2022]
Abstract
An isolated increase of blood tumor marker CA 15.3 in breast cancer is considered a sensitive indicator for occult metastatic disease but by itself is not sufficient for initiating therapeutic intervention. We investigated the potential of camera-based positron emission tomography (PET) imaging using [18F]-fluorodeoxyglucose (FDG) to detect clinically occult recurrences in 132 female patients (age, 35-69 years) treated for breast cancer, all presenting with an isolated increase in blood tumor marker CA 15.3 without any other evidence of metastatic disease. FDG results were correlated to pathology results or to a sequentially guided conventional imaging method. One hundred nineteen patients were eligible for correlations. Positive FDG scans were obtained for 106 patients, including 89 with a single lesion and 17 with 2 or more lesion. There were 92 true-positive and 14 false-positive cases, 10 of which became true positive within 1 year. Among the 13 negative cases, 7 were false negative and 6 were true negative. Camera-based PET using FDG has successfully identified clinically occult disease with an overall sensitivity of 93.6% and a positive predictive value of 96.2%. The smallest detected size was 6 mm for a lymph node metastasis (tumor to nontumor ratio, 4:2). FDG camera-based PET localized tumors in 85.7% of cases suspected for clinically occult metastatic disease on the basis of a significant increase in blood tumor marker. A positive FDG scan associated with an elevated CA 15.3 level is most consistent with metastatic relapse of breast cancer.

Alberini JL, Badran A, Freneaux E, Hadji S, Kalifa G, Devaux JY, Dupont T. Technetium-99m HMPAO-labeled leukocyte imaging compared with endoscopy, ultrasonography, and contrast radiology in children with inflammatory bowel disease. J Pediatr Gastroenterol Nutr 2001; 32:278-86. [PMID: 11345176 DOI: 10.1097/00005176-200103000-00009] [Citation(s) in RCA: 33] [Impact Index Per Article: 1.4] [Reference Citation Analysis] [What about the content of this article? (0)] [Affiliation(s)] [Abstract] [MESH Headings] [Track Full Text] [Journal Information] [Submit a Manuscript] [Subscribe] [Scholar Register] [Indexed: 12/10/2022]
Abstract
BACKGROUND The purpose of this study was to evaluate retrospectively the value of leukocyte-labeled scintigraphy, ultrasonography, and contrast radiography compared with endoscopy in children suspected of having inflammatory bowel disease (IBD). METHODS Twenty-eight children (17 boys; mean age, 10.2 years) with IBD based on standard colonoscopic, histologic, and radiologic criteria (16 with Crohn's disease, 5 with ulcerative colitis, 5 with nonspecific colitis, I with granulomatous disease, and I with Beh,cet's disease) were included. Endoscopic, ultrasonographic, and contrast radiologic examinations were realized for 28, 23, and 19 children respectively. RESULTS Sensitivity and specificity were 75% and 92% for leukocyte-labeled scintigraphy, 39% and 90% for ultrasonography, and 58% and 83% for contrast radiography. The authors noted discontinuous uptake for 14 of 15 true-positive results for patients with Crohn's disease and continuous uptake for 4 of 4 true-positive results for patients with ulcerative colitis. A negative correlation between scan activity index and Lloyd-Still clinical score was found for 11 patients with Crohn's disease (r = -0.77). CONCLUSIONS Leukocyte-labeled scintigraphy, a noninvasive and reproducible technique, is a useful tool in the diagnosis and therapeutic strategy of IBD, and provides information on the presence, the intensity, and the extent of the disease, particularly in the terminal ileum. Leukocyte-labeled scintigraphy may not replace colonoscopy with biopsies for diagnosis confirmation. Its reliability seems higher than that of ultrasonography.
